About Loki
Hi my name is Loki and I’m six months old. I’m looking for my forever family and I’m ready to choose you…if you have the right situation for me.
I’m looking for a family. I love kids and people of all ages, but I’m too boisterous for little tiny kids or elderly people who might be on a frame or walking stick. I might accidentally knock them over as I want to play and race a lot, and when I wag I wag my whole body and my tail is like a whip. I want a house with a yard big enough for me to play and run, so no apartments or townhouses please.
I love dogs! All dogs! I want to play with them all and I don’t understand that some of them may not want to know me or play with me. I tend to get into their faces and invade their personal space. My family will need to continue teaching me to approach politely and to respect other dogs need for space. Also they’ll need to continue teaching me not to play too rough, though I only do that with a like-minded buddy. I’d love to have a sibling to play with everyday - he’ll need tolerance and plenty of energy. I also like cats, though I’m not sure if they like me.
I have been learning lots of things in my foster home. I can sit and drop on command, and I’m doing well with staying in position. I am not keen to walk calmly but I’m getting the idea and you’ll need to help me continue, and coming when called…well I do, mostly, sometimes…well ok not reliably yet but when I do, look out it’s a hundred miles an hour. I have been learning also about not jumping up or barging in the house until invited. I need to also learn about not chewing stuff…I’m still a pup in that way… and I do forget sometimes.
My family should be active and want to include me in their activities. I won’t like to be in a yard by myself all the time and I’ll sook and cry…I’m still a bit self centred and foster mum says I’m a perpetual sook. Don’t know what she means! Adoption details
1. Fall in love with Loki and read his full profile.
2. Email us for an application form.
3. Wait for us to contact you if you are shortlisted for adoption. A trainer may telephone you for additional information or simply to arrange for a meet and greet with our dog at a mutually agreeable time.
5. If you are the successful applicant and you wish to go ahead with the adoption process please decide what level of adoption you would like to proceed with.
Adoption Only – your adoption fee is $450. Your new dog comes desexed, vaccinated and microchipped, and with a collar.
Adoption with Assistance – your adoption fee is $550. Your new dog comes desexed, vaccinated and microchipped, with a collar and a training halter. A short introductory lesson with one of our trainers to help settle your dog in and introduce the fundamentals of the training your dog has been receiving whilst in foster care is also included. This will be conducted in your home if within 50 klm of the fostercarer, otherwise at an alternative venue by mutual agreement.
Adoption and Training – your adoption fee is $750. Your new dog comes desexed, vaccinated and microchipped and with a collar. Plus training equipment (lead & head halter) and two private lessons to help you understand the foundations of all obedience and general behaviour shaping techniques that your new dog has been learning whilst in foster care with one of our trainer/trainers. These will be conducted in your home if within 50 klm of the fostercarer, otherwise at an alternative venue by mutual agreement. Ongoing support is also included if you need some extra assistance to help your new forever friend settle into your family.
6. Pay your adoption fee, sign our adoption papers and arrange handover of your new best friend. A two week trial period begins at this point and flows automatically into adoption if both parties are happy.
